Kottikärry, often referred to as a wheelbarrow in English, is a hand-propelled vehicle, usually with one wheel, designed for carrying loads. It typically consists of a basin or tray, two handles, and a single wheel at the front. The operator grips the handles and uses their body weight to lift the load, walk, and then tip the basin to unload.
